Pallas

2007 Sonoma Valley Cabernet Sauvignon

Imagery Pallas is a captivating Cabernet Sauvignon from the renowned Sonoma Valley, hailing from the exceptional vintage of 2007. This alluring red wine presents a deep, rich color that hints at its complexity. On the palate, it offers a well-rounded body that is both substantial and elegant, complemented by bright acidity that invigorates the senses. The fruit intensity shines through with prominent notes of blackberry and blackcurrant, while subtle undertones of chocolate and spice add depth to its character. The tannins are notably firm yet refined, providing a structured mouthfeel that promises longevity and aging potential. Overall, this wine is meticulously crafted to showcase the rich terroir of Sonoma Valley, making it a delightful choice for any occasion.

Region:


Sonoma Valley

Situated between the Mayacamas and Sonoma mountain ranges, wine has been made here since 1825. It is unsurprising, then, that it is home to ancient Zinfandel vines—some of which are more than a century old. You will mainly find these in the northern reaches of the valley, growing alongside Cabernet Sauvignon. The warm and sunny climate results in bold reds with concentrated fruit flavors. But that is not the entire story of this valley. For crisp and elegant wines, look to the southern stretches, where the cooling influence of the Pacific Ocean and San Pablo Bay helps to develop elegant Pinot Noir and bright, crisp Chardonnay.
